Why CAPM? A World of Advantages

Earning your CAPM certification isn't just about adding a fancy acronym to your resume. It's about acquiring a recognized industry credential that validates your understanding of fundamental project management principles and practices. Here are some of the compelling reasons why CAPM training can be your career game-changer:

โ€ข Enhanced Knowledge and Skills: The CAPM curriculum covers the core ten knowledge areas of project management, including project integration, scope, schedule, cost, quality, human resources, communications, risk, procurement, and stakeholder management. This comprehensive training equips you with the essential tools and techniques to effectively plan, execute, and control projects, regardless of their size or complexity.

Demystifying the CAPM Exam: What to Expect

Now that you're convinced about the power of CAPM training, let's delve into the nitty-gritty of the exam itself. The CAPM exam is a multiple-choice computer-based test that assesses your understanding of the ten project management knowledge areas. Here's a quick breakdown of what you can expect:

โ€ข The test has 150 questions where you choose the best answer out of several options. You get 3 hours to complete it, so plan your time wisely!

โ€ข Content: The questions cover all ten project management knowledge areas, with varying degrees of emphasis based on their relative importance.

โ€ข Difficulty: The exam is designed to be challenging but achievable for individuals with a solid understanding of project management fundamentals.

โ€ข Preparation: Numerous resources are available to help you prepare for the exam, including study guides, practice tests, online courses, and boot camps.

CAPM Training Options: Charting Your Course

Several CAPM training options are available to cater to different learning styles and preferences. Here are some popular choices:

โ€ข Self-study: If you're a self-motivated learner, you can purchase study guides, practice tests, and online resources to prepare for the exam at your own pace.

โ€ข Online courses: Many online platforms offer comprehensive CAPM certification training courses that provide structured learning modules, interactive exercises, and instructor support.

โ€ข Boot camps: These intensive, in-person or online programs offer accelerated CAPM preparation within a short timeframe. They're ideal for individuals who prefer a more immersive learning experience.

โ€ข Classroom training: Traditional classroom training provides face-to-face interaction with instructors and the opportunity to network with other aspiring project managers.

Beyond the Exam: A Lifelong Journey

Remember, CAPM certification is just the beginning of your project management journey. The field is constantly evolving, and continuous learning is crucial for staying ahead of the curve. Here are some ways to keep your skills sharp and stay relevant:

โ€ข Earn additional certifications: As you gain experience, consider pursuing advanced project management certifications such as the Project Management Professional (PMPยฎ) or PMI Agile Certified Practitioner (PMI-ACPยฎ). These advanced certifications demonstrate your in-depth expertise and open doors to leadership roles.

โ€ข Continue learning: Stay updated on the latest trends and best practices in project management by attending workshops, conferences, and webinars. Numerous online resources, blogs, and podcasts also offer valuable insights and thought leadership perspectives.

โ€ข Join professional organizations: Participating in professional organizations like the Project Management Institute (PMI) connects you with a global network of practitioners, provides access to educational resources, and offers opportunities for professional development.

โ€ข Volunteer your skills: Volunteering your project management skills to non-profit organizations or community projects is a fantastic way to gain practical experience, give back to society, and build your portfolio.

โ€ข Become a mentor: As you gain experience, consider mentoring aspiring project managers. Sharing your knowledge and experiences can be incredibly rewarding and helps cultivate the next generation of project management professionals.
